Red-bellied short-necked turtle is middle size fresh water turtle from Australia and Papua New Guinea. It is the most colourful turtle of Australia a due to its smaller size it is also a great pet. They are easy to keep and you can feed them with invertebrates, meat or pellets. As they are carnivorous, they don´t need UVB lighting. They are great swimmers so it is best to offer them bigger space to do so.
